Department of Post (India Post) has released the 1st Merit List for Gramin Dak Sevak (GDS) Recruitment 2026. A total of 28,636 GDS positions are available across all states/circles of India. The application process ran from 31 January to 14 February 2026. Candidates shortlisted in the merit list must now prepare for Document Verification.

India Post GDS recruitment is merit-based — no written examination. Selection is entirely based on Class 10th marks. Candidates with higher 10th percentage get preference. This is one of India's largest annual recruitments, offering permanent government job as Gramin Dak Sevak (Branch Postmaster, Assistant Branch Postmaster, Dak Sevak) in rural post offices.

  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A  

Post NameGramin Dak Sewak (GDS) — Branch Postmaster (BPM), Assistant BPM, Dak Sevak
Minimum EducationClass 10th (Matric / High School) Pass from any recognized Board
Compulsory SubjectsMathematics + English as separate subjects. Must have passed both.
Computer KnowledgeBasic computer knowledge required — BPM/ABPM posts require computer literacy
Local LanguageCandidate must know the local language of the division where vacancy exists
Merit Basis100% merit-based on Class 10th aggregate marks. NO interview or written exam.
NationalityIndian Citizen

  HOW TO CHECK INDIA POST GDS 1st MERIT LIST 2026  

  ▶  Step 1: Visit indiapostgdsonline.gov.in (India Post GDS official website)

  ▶  Step 2: Click on 'Shortlisted Candidates – 1st Merit List 2026' link

  ▶  Step 3: Select your Circle / State from the dropdown list

  ▶  Step 4: The Merit List PDF will open — use Ctrl+F to search your Registration Number or Name

  ▶  Step 5: If your name/registration number appears, you are shortlisted for Document Verification

  ▶  Step 6: Note your DV date, time, and venue (mentioned in the notification/circle website)

  ▶  Step 7: Prepare all original documents: 10th Marksheet, DOB proof, Caste Certificate (if applicable), Computer Certificate, Local language proof, Aadhaar, 2 passport photos

  ▶  Step 8: Attend Document Verification on the scheduled date at the designated Post Office / Divisional Office

  ▶  What if NOT in Merit List: Keep checking — 2nd and 3rd merit lists will also be released if seats remain after DV.

  F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S (FAQs)  

What is GDS full form?Gramin Dak Sevak — postal workers working in rural/semi-rural Branch Post Offices under Dept. of Posts
What is GDS pay?Rs. 10,000 – Rs. 14,500/month (Time Related Continuity Allowance — TRCA). Not a regular pay scale but a fixed allowance.
Is GDS a permanent govt job?Yes — GDS is a permanent, pensionable position. Though not a regular civil servant, GDS has defined service conditions, leave, and gratuity benefits.
When is 2nd Merit List?2nd Merit List released after 1st DV round — typically 4-6 weeks after 1st merit list. Keep checking indiapostgdsonline.gov.in
Can I get transferred?GDS transfers are allowed within the same Division after completion of minimum 5 years of service.
